Obverse description Christ Pantokrator enthroned facing, nimbate with cruciform nimbus bearing pellets on the arms, robed in imperial loros and maphorion, holding the Gospels in His left hand and raising His right hand in blessing. The elaborately jewelled throne with lyre-shaped back and footrest is rendered in fine detail. The Christogram IC XC appears in the fields to left and right of the figure, all within a beaded inner circle typical of Comnenian scyphate coinage.
